Beispiel #1
0
        public List <Model.status> Select()
        {
            List <Model.status> ListaStatus = new List <Model.status>();
            SqlConnection       conexao     = new SqlConnection(strCon);
            string     sql = "Select * from status;";
            SqlCommand cmd = new SqlCommand(sql, conexao);

            conexao.Open();
            try
            {
                SqlDataReader reader = cmd.ExecuteReader(CommandBehavior.CloseConnection);
                while (reader.Read())
                {
                    Model.status status = new Model.status();
                    status.idStatus    = Convert.ToInt32(reader[0].ToString());
                    status.desc_status = reader["desc_status"].ToString();
                    ListaStatus.Add(status);
                }
            }
            catch
            {
                Console.WriteLine("Deu erro na execução de status ...");
            }
            finally
            {
                conexao.Close();
            }
            return(ListaStatus);
        }
Beispiel #2
0
        public void Delete(Model.status status)
        {
            SqlConnection conexao = new SqlConnection(strCon);
            string        sql     = "Delete from status where idStatus=@idStatus;";
            SqlCommand    cmd     = new SqlCommand(sql, conexao);

            cmd.Parameters.AddWithValue("@idStatus", status.idStatus);
            conexao.Open();
            try
            {
                cmd.ExecuteNonQuery();
            }
            catch
            {
                Console.WriteLine("Erro na remoção de status ...");
            }
            finally
            {
                conexao.Close();
            }
        }
Beispiel #3
0
        public void Insert(Model.status status)
        {
            SqlConnection conexao = new SqlConnection(strCon);
            string        sql     = "Insert into status values (@desc_status)";
            SqlCommand    cmd     = new SqlCommand(sql, conexao);

            cmd.Parameters.AddWithValue("@desc_status", status.desc_status);
            conexao.Open();
            try
            {
                cmd.ExecuteNonQuery();
            }
            catch
            {
                Console.WriteLine("Deu erro na inserção de status ...");
            }
            finally
            {
                conexao.Close();
            }
        }
Beispiel #4
0
        public void Update(Model.status status)
        {
            SqlConnection conexao = new SqlConnection(strCon);
            string        sql     = "Update status set desc_status=@desc_status";

            sql += " where idStatus=@idStatus;";
            SqlCommand cmd = new SqlCommand(sql, conexao);

            cmd.Parameters.AddWithValue("@idStatus", status.idStatus);
            cmd.Parameters.AddWithValue("@desc_status", status.desc_status);
            conexao.Open();
            try
            {
                cmd.ExecuteNonQuery();
            }
            catch
            {
                Console.WriteLine("Deu erro na atualização de status ...");
            }
            finally
            {
                conexao.Close();
            }
        }
Beispiel #5
0
 public void Delete(Model.status status)
 {
     DAL.status dalStatus = new DAL.status();
     dalStatus.Delete(status);
 }
Beispiel #6
0
 public void Update(Model.status status)
 {
     DAL.status dalStatus = new DAL.status();
     dalStatus.Update(status);
 }
Beispiel #7
0
 public void Insert(Model.status status)
 {
     DAL.status dalStatus = new DAL.status();
     dalStatus.Insert(status);
 }